
Recognizing a pulled muscle, also known as a muscle strain, involves identifying specific symptoms that indicate damage to the muscle fibers or tendons. Common signs include sudden pain or discomfort during physical activity, localized tenderness, swelling, and bruising around the affected area. You may also experience reduced strength or flexibility in the injured muscle, along with stiffness or difficulty moving the affected limb. Mild strains might cause slight discomfort, while severe cases can result in significant pain and limited mobility. If you suspect a pulled muscle, it’s important to assess the severity and consider rest, ice, compression, and elevation (RICE) as initial treatment steps, while seeking medical advice for persistent or severe symptoms.

Sudden Sharp Pain During Activity
A sudden, sharp pain during physical activity is often the first unmistakable sign of a pulled muscle. This acute discomfort typically occurs when the muscle is stretched beyond its limit or forced to contract against resistance it’s unprepared for. Imagine lifting a heavy box and feeling a searing pain in your lower back, or sprinting and experiencing a sharp twinge in your hamstring—these are classic scenarios. The pain is immediate and localized, often so intense that it halts the activity altogether. Unlike gradual soreness, which might develop over hours or days, this pain is instantaneous, leaving no room for doubt about what just happened.
Analyzing the mechanics behind this pain reveals why it’s such a clear indicator of a pulled muscle. When muscle fibers tear, either partially or fully, the body’s nociceptors (pain receptors) fire rapidly, signaling tissue damage. This is the body’s way of saying, “Stop what you’re doing—now.” The sharpness of the pain is directly related to the severity of the injury; a mild pull might feel like a quick pinch, while a severe tear can be debilitating. For instance, a grade 1 strain (mild) might allow you to continue the activity with discomfort, whereas a grade 3 strain (severe) could render the muscle completely nonfunctional. Understanding this distinction is crucial for determining the next steps in treatment and recovery.
If you experience this type of pain, the first step is to cease the activity immediately. Continuing to move the affected muscle can exacerbate the injury, turning a minor pull into a major strain. Apply the RICE protocol (Rest, Ice, Compression, Elevation) within the first 24–48 hours to reduce inflammation and pain. Rest is non-negotiable; avoid any movement that triggers pain. Ice the area for 20 minutes every 1–2 hours, using a compression wrap to minimize swelling. Elevation helps reduce fluid buildup, particularly for injuries in the legs or arms. Over-the-counter pain relievers like ibuprofen (400–600 mg every 6 hours) can manage pain and inflammation, but avoid them if you have underlying health conditions.
Comparing this scenario to other types of activity-related pain highlights its uniqueness. For example, delayed onset muscle soreness (DOMS) typically appears 24–72 hours after unfamiliar exercise and feels like a dull ache rather than a sharp pain. Similarly, joint pain or tendonitis often presents as a persistent discomfort during movement, not an abrupt, localized spike. The suddenness and intensity of a pulled muscle’s pain are its defining characteristics, making it relatively easy to diagnose in the moment. However, if the pain persists beyond a few days or is accompanied by severe swelling, bruising, or numbness, seek medical attention to rule out more serious injuries like a rupture or nerve damage.
In practical terms, preventing this type of injury involves proper warm-up and gradual progression in activity intensity. Dynamic stretches before exercise prepare muscles for the range of motion they’ll undergo, while strength training builds resilience against sudden stress. For example, athletes often incorporate exercises like lunges or resistance band pulls to target muscle groups prone to strains. Hydration and adequate nutrition also play a role, as dehydrated or nutrient-depleted muscles are more susceptible to injury. By recognizing the immediate signals of a pulled muscle and responding appropriately, you can minimize recovery time and avoid further damage, ensuring a quicker return to your active lifestyle.

Localized Tenderness or Swelling
A pulled muscle, medically known as a muscle strain, often announces itself through localized tenderness or swelling. This symptom is your body’s immediate response to the microscopic tears in the muscle fibers or the surrounding tissues. When you press on the affected area, you’ll likely feel a sharp or dull pain that wasn’t there before. This tenderness is a red flag, signaling that the muscle has been overstretched or torn. Swelling, though less immediate, usually follows as the body rushes blood and fluids to the injured site to begin the healing process.
To identify localized tenderness, perform a simple self-assessment. Gently press around the area where you suspect the injury, comparing it to the same spot on the opposite side of your body. If the pressure elicits pain or discomfort, it’s a strong indicator of a pulled muscle. Swelling may be more visible, appearing as a slight puffiness or warmth in the area. For example, a strained calf muscle might feel tender to the touch and look slightly larger than the uninjured leg. These symptoms typically appear within hours of the injury and can worsen with movement.
While localized tenderness and swelling are common with pulled muscles, they can also mimic other conditions, such as tendonitis or a stress fracture. To differentiate, consider the context of the injury. Did it occur during a sudden movement, like lifting a heavy object or sprinting? If so, a muscle strain is more likely. However, if the pain developed gradually or persists without a clear cause, consult a healthcare professional. Applying ice to the area can help reduce swelling and numb the pain, but avoid direct ice contact with the skin—wrap it in a cloth and apply for 15–20 minutes every 1–2 hours in the first 48 hours.
For practical management, rest the affected muscle to prevent further damage. Elevating the injured area above heart level can minimize swelling, especially in the first 24–48 hours. Over-the-counter anti-inflammatory medications like ibuprofen (200–400 mg every 4–6 hours, as needed) can help reduce both pain and swelling, but always follow the recommended dosage and consult a doctor if you have underlying health conditions. Avoid massaging the area immediately, as it can exacerbate swelling and delay healing. Instead, focus on gentle stretching once the acute phase has passed, typically after 48–72 hours.
In summary, localized tenderness and swelling are hallmark signs of a pulled muscle, serving as your body’s alarm system for injury. By recognizing these symptoms and responding with appropriate care—rest, ice, elevation, and cautious use of anti-inflammatories—you can support the healing process and prevent complications. However, if symptoms persist beyond a week or worsen despite treatment, seek medical attention to rule out more serious conditions.

Limited Range of Motion
A pulled muscle, medically known as a muscle strain, often announces itself through a telltale sign: limited range of motion. This restriction occurs because the injured muscle fibers or surrounding tissues become inflamed and tender, making movement painful or mechanically impossible. For instance, a strained hamstring might prevent you from fully extending your leg, while a pulled shoulder muscle could limit your ability to lift your arm overhead. Recognizing this symptom is crucial, as it not only signals the injury but also guides the appropriate level of rest and rehabilitation needed to prevent further damage.
To assess limited range of motion, perform gentle, controlled movements in the affected area. Compare the mobility to the uninjured side or recall your normal flexibility. For example, if you suspect a pulled calf muscle, try to stand on your tiptoes or flex your foot upward. If you experience sharp pain or notice a significant reduction in movement, it’s likely a strain. Avoid forcing the motion, as this can exacerbate the injury. Instead, use this observation as a diagnostic tool to determine the severity of the strain—mild, moderate, or severe—and tailor your response accordingly.
Incorporating practical tips can help manage this symptom effectively. Applying ice for 15–20 minutes every 1–2 hours during the first 48 hours reduces inflammation and numbs pain, potentially improving mobility slightly. Gentle stretching, once acute pain subsides, can gradually restore range of motion, but avoid overstretching, which can cause further harm. For example, a seated hamstring stretch with a 5–10 second hold, repeated 3–5 times daily, can be beneficial for a mild strain. Always prioritize pain-free movements and consult a physical therapist for a personalized plan if symptoms persist beyond a week.
Comparatively, limited range of motion in a pulled muscle differs from that caused by joint injuries or neurological conditions. In muscle strains, the restriction is often localized to the affected muscle group and improves with rest and targeted care. In contrast, joint issues like a sprain may involve swelling and instability, while neurological problems can cause widespread stiffness or weakness. Understanding this distinction ensures you address the root cause rather than merely treating symptoms. For instance, a pulled groin muscle may limit lateral leg movement, whereas a hip joint injury could affect overall leg rotation.
Finally, monitoring your progress is essential. If limited range of motion persists or worsens despite rest and home care, seek medical attention. Persistent immobility could indicate a more severe injury, such as a muscle tear or tendon damage, requiring professional intervention. For older adults or individuals with chronic conditions, even minor strains can lead to prolonged recovery times, making early assessment and tailored management critical. By recognizing and addressing this symptom promptly, you can minimize downtime and return to full function safely.

Bruising or Discoloration
To assess bruising related to a pulled muscle, examine the affected area for tenderness and swelling. Gently press around the discolored zone—if pain radiates or the area feels warm, it likely involves deeper tissue damage. Note the bruise’s progression: fresh injuries appear reddish, while older ones shift to yellow or brown as the body reabsorbs the blood. Persistent or spreading discoloration warrants medical attention, as it could indicate a more severe injury like a hematoma.
Contrast bruising from a pulled muscle with that from a bone fracture or joint injury. Muscle bruises tend to be diffuse and spread over a broader area, whereas fractures often cause localized, sharp-edged discoloration. Joint injuries may show bruising accompanied by visible deformity or instability. If unsure, apply the RICE protocol (Rest, Ice, Compression, Elevation) for 48 hours—if the bruise worsens or pain intensifies, consult a healthcare provider.
Preventing bruising starts with proper warm-up and gradual progression in physical activity. For older adults or those on blood thinners, even minor muscle strains can lead to pronounced bruising due to reduced blood clotting ability. Wearing protective gear during high-impact sports and maintaining muscle flexibility through regular stretching can minimize the risk. Remember, while bruising is common with pulled muscles, its presence should prompt careful monitoring to ensure proper healing.

Persistent Muscle Weakness or Stiffness
To assess whether you’re dealing with persistent weakness or stiffness, perform a simple range-of-motion test. For example, if you suspect a pulled hamstring, try to touch your toes or lift your leg straight out in front of you. Compare the affected side to the uninjured side; limited mobility or a sharp increase in stiffness during the movement suggests a strain. Another practical tip is to monitor how the muscle responds to gentle stretching. Mild discomfort is normal, but if stretching exacerbates the stiffness or causes sharp pain, it’s a sign to stop and reevaluate. Ignoring these signals can lead to further injury, as overstressing a pulled muscle delays healing and may cause chronic issues.
From a comparative standpoint, muscle stiffness from a pulled muscle differs from conditions like arthritis or fibromyalgia. While arthritis often causes joint stiffness that improves with movement, a muscle strain typically worsens with activity. Fibromyalgia, on the other hand, presents as widespread pain and tenderness, not localized stiffness or weakness. If your symptoms are confined to a specific muscle group and accompanied by recent overexertion or trauma, a pulled muscle is the more likely culprit. However, if stiffness is persistent, unexplained, or accompanied by systemic symptoms like fever or fatigue, consult a healthcare professional to rule out underlying conditions.
For those experiencing persistent weakness or stiffness, active recovery is key—but it must be approached cautiously. Start with low-impact activities like walking or swimming to promote blood flow without straining the muscle. Incorporate gentle stretching exercises, holding each stretch for 20–30 seconds, and avoid bouncing, which can aggravate the injury. Applying heat after 48 hours can relax tight muscles, while ice remains beneficial in the initial days to reduce inflammation. If weakness persists beyond two weeks despite rest and self-care, seek physical therapy. A trained therapist can design a targeted program to restore strength and flexibility, ensuring a full recovery and preventing future injuries.
Finally, prevention is just as critical as treatment. Persistent muscle weakness or stiffness often stems from overuse, improper technique, or inadequate warm-ups. Adults over 40, in particular, should prioritize dynamic stretching before exercise, as muscles become less elastic with age. Incorporate strength training 2–3 times per week to build resilience, focusing on compound movements that engage multiple muscle groups. Stay hydrated, as dehydration can contribute to stiffness, and ensure your diet includes adequate protein (0.8–1.2 grams per kilogram of body weight daily) to support muscle repair. By addressing the root causes of weakness and stiffness, you not only recover from a pulled muscle but also reduce the risk of recurrence.
